Transaction 32c3a22cf5c5d61dd8c90901d96fadfe1125de6ccd2a6cde270ddabdec751598
1 Input
1 Output
-
32c3a22cf5c5d61dd8c90901d96fadfe1125de6ccd2a6cde270ddabdec751598:0
- value
- 80856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 983ae32db1520ab5ca3a1db478543c81d579e3bd OP_EQUAL
- address
- 3FZwBGh8yZPVaiay74iXLvosMqg6rDeB5s